Latest Patents

One of his latest patents is titled "Methods and compositions for targeting developmental and oncogenic programs in H3K27M gliomas." This patent discloses compositions and methods aimed at treating diffuse gliomas with histone H3 lysine27-to-methionine mutations (H3K27M-gliomas). The invention includes gene signatures specific for tumor cell types and treatment compositions targeting PRC1 in H3K27M-gliomas.

Another notable patent is "Methods and compositions for treating cancer by targeting the CLEC2D-KLRB1 pathway." This patent provides methods and compositions for treating cancer by blocking the interaction of KLRB1 with its ligand, which is crucial for inhibiting the cytotoxic function of NK cells. The agent may include an antibody or fragment that binds to KLRB1 or CLEC2D, showcasing Tirosh's innovative approach to cancer treatment.
